When I get aorund to it, I'll buy a progressive, but till then, I'll tell you what I do with pistol ammo.
I do 500-600 cases at a time.
I clean the cases in a tumbler.
Then, I sit in front of the TV with the cases, and a LEE handpress.
I size them all.
Then i expand them all.
Then I use a hand primer to prime them all.
ALl this is done in front of the TV, in a few evenings.
I use 2 tupperware containers, pick up the brass form one, size it, throw it in the other. Same with expanding and priming.
Then I'll charge about 150 at a time with a powder thrower, and seat the bulets on my ROckchucker.
Although, I must add, I am a low volume pistol shooter. :wink:
LEE hand press is $25. LEE hand primer is about $35, and you need the shell holders for it. You may as well spend another $15 on the full set of shell holders.
